QUETTA: Balochistan High Court (BHC) has ordered to close of the case against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) leader Shahbaz Gill registered in Killa Abdullah.
Balochistan High Court Judge Justice Abdul Hameed Baloch heard the petition for the quashing of the case registered against Shahbaz Gill for his statement against institutions.
PTI leader Shahbaz Gill’s case was followed by Syed Iqbal Shah Advocate, Shams Rind Advocate, and others of the Insaf Lawyer Forum.
Shahbaz Gill’s lawyer Iqbal Shah Advocate told the court that like Senator Azam Swati, an FIR was filed against Shahbaz Gill in Balochistan, and a petition has been submitted in the Balochistan High Court today to quash it.
The court remarked how the Killa Abdullah case was classified as a single case, the Supreme Court judges that there cannot be two cases of the same incident.
The court, while pronouncing its verdict, ordered to close the case registered against PTI leader Shahbaz Gill in the Killa Abdullah district of Balochistan.
It should be noted that the Balochistan Police had summoned PTI leader Shehbaz Gill in connection with the sedition case filed in Killa Abdullah.
According to the police, the First Information Report (FIR) filed against PTI leader Shahbaz Gill contained seven provisions of the PECA Act.
On the other hand, Syed Iqbal Shah, the lawyer of PTI leader Shehbaz Gul, while talking to Bol News, said that the High Court of Balochistan has fulfilled the demands of justice by closing the baseless cases for the first time.
He said that the cases against Azam Swati and Shehbaz Gill have been closed by the Balochistan High Court for the first time in Pakistan.
